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97491 26609 6154688
19506427 28982103238
19506427 28982103238
9013 3691102 9815 904321
All about undefined
Interested in learning more?
19506427 28982103238
9013 3691102 9815 904321
See more
423063004 811
8693 552 651 2561
See more
12018820882 848
81680676829 05193545 98 7373439
See more